A good efficient roof cleaning formula is 1 gal chlorox 1 gal water 4 oz of dishwashing detergent that doesn t contain ammonia and is safe to mix with bleach and 4 oz of sodium silicate same as sodium metasilicate often available in bags at auto parts stores sold as radiator.
